- Growing Applications in Fire Retardants
ATH is increasingly used in fire retardant formulations due to its effectiveness and safety profile. The construction and automotive industries are major consumers, with a reported 20% rise in ATH usage in these sectors. Regulatory bodies are mandating stricter fire safety standards, which could further boost demand. This trend indicates a shift towards safer materials in high-risk applications.
- Expansion in the Plastics Industry
The plastics industry is adopting ATH as a filler to enhance properties like thermal stability and flame resistance. Reports indicate a 12% increase in ATH consumption in plastic composites. Major manufacturers are reformulating products to meet new regulations, driving further growth. This trend suggests a potential for ATH to become a standard additive in various plastic applications.

- Shift Towards High-Performance Materials
There is a growing trend towards high-performance ATH products that offer superior properties for specialized applications. Industries such as aerospace and electronics are increasingly utilizing ATH for its thermal and electrical insulation properties. This shift is supported by a 10% increase in R&D investments in high-performance materials. Future developments may focus on enhancing ATH's performance characteristics to meet specific industry needs.
